Abstract
A novel 4-point ternary interpolatory subdivision scheme with a tension parameter is analyzed. It is shown that for a certain range of the tension parameter the resulting curve is C2. The role of the tension parameter is demonstrated by a few examples. There is a brief discussion of computational costs.
